Over 11,000 Children in Odisha at Risk of Child Marriage, NCPCR Report Reveals

A recent report by the National Commission for Protection of Child Rights (NCPCR) has highlighted a concerning issue in Odisha, where over 11,000 children are vulnerable to child marriages. Australia’s Marsh out of England game, back home for personal reasons

New Delhi, 11/2: Australia will be without Mitchell Marsh for their World Cup game against England this week after the all-rounder returned home to Perth for personal reasons, the country’s cricket board said on Thursday. Kerala govt to appeal against acquittal of actor Dileep in 2017 actress assault case soon

Kochi, 23/12: The Kerala government will soon file an appeal against the verdict in the 2017 actress assault case, challenging both the acquittal of actor Dileep and the sentences awarded to six convicts, sources said on Tuesday.
